
Riona Moodley
Riona Moodley is a researcher from the University of New South Wales' Institute of Climate Risk and Response, known for her expertise in climate change and its impact on vulnerable communities. Following a recent court decision regarding climate policy and the Torres Strait Islands, she emphasized the need for Australian law to evolve in response to the challenges posed by climate change.
